Minding their mental health, diaspora connecting online

It was on the eve of St Patrick s Day 2020, that the British Prime Minister Boris Johnson first announced new measures aimed at avoiding gatherings in crowded places, such as pubs, nightclubs and theatres. The huge annual parade through London, which traditionally attracts up to 50,000 people, had already been cancelled due to Covid-19 health advice. With few people yet familiar with the online world of Zoom, and with little time to organise any last-minute virtual events, the day was passed by many of the Irish in Britain and abroad, sitting at home for the first time. It was a very strange state of affairs. Basically everyone’s plans were cancelled, says Ruairí Cullen, policy officer with Irish in Britain, a charity supporting a wide network of Irish organisations across Britain. 

Late Late St Patrick s Day special line up, virtual events, and Irish artists performing online

While we are unfortunately unable to gather on the streets this St Patrick’s Day, that doesn’t mean we can’t celebrate in other ways. Hundreds of virtual events are taking place all over the world to mark our national holiday, celebrating the art, culture, and music of Ireland. Brendan Gleeson, The Corrs, and Kojaque are among the Irish talent celebrating St Patrick’s Day online this year. President Michael D Higgins will be kicking off the day at 10.52am with a St Patrick’s Day message over on the official St Patrick’s Day Festival website, followed by the RTÉ virtual parade which will see people broadcast their own parades from their homes.
